If you pulled it, you got full credit. That's how it works. I can confirm this as I have been solo, done nothing more than claim A-ranks and let the zerg kill them. 100% contribution. Several times.
If no-one in your group got any credit at all, you all managed to fail to hit the mob. Even one hit on the mob gets you a minimum of one seal.
If you honestly hold that you hit the mob and that your group pulled but nobody got any rewards, file a bug report because that's just not the way they work. Of course you could just be misremembering/lying.
